As highly sensitives in business and leadership, our relationship with money is a mirror of our deepest patterns, beliefs, and sense of self-worth. In these extraordinary times, when the terrain of both business and money is shifting quickly, evolving our relationship and mindset around money is no longer optional—it is essential. Moving into what I call “Money Mindset 2.0” requires courage, self-inquiry, and a willingness to release limiting beliefs that no longer serve us. This deeper level of awareness and transformation allows us to create an empowered relationship with money that in turn supports with less effort, more impact, and more income as a highly sensitive leader.
In this episode, I discuss the challenges of long-held limiting beliefs and patterns around money. I talk about my own money story along with personal reflections from my family of origin, and pivotal turning points in my money mindset journey—including filing for bankruptcy and building my business from the ground up. I also share insights inspired by Louise Hay’s teachings, and invite you to explore your own money story in a powerful new way. Be sure to listen until the end, where you’ll be invited to engage with two intentional assignments to support you with uncovering your own limiting beliefs about money and to instead align yourself with abundance and peace. If you’re ready to shift your money mindset as an HSP in business and leadership, this episode is for you.
